
About This Coffee
This coffee is a single origin from Rwanda's Nyabihu District at 2000 to 2400 meters altitude, the highest-grown coffee region in the country. The Gesha variety is processed washed with traditional foot-stomping fermentation. It offers bright, elegant flavors with sweet notes including juicy orange, milk chocolate, and oolong, suited for filter brewing with a clean and structured cup profile.

Bell Lane Coffee Roasters
Bell Lane Coffee Roasters, founded in Mullingar in 2012, operates as a Certified B Corporation and prioritizes direct‑trade sourcing and long‑term producer partnerships that support both quality and community livelihoods.
